For guests who want to explore, Vlora Llogara Pass Mountain View makes an ideal base. Hiking trails begin just beyond the property, leading you through fragrant pine forest to natural viewpoints that overlook both the mountains and the sea. Adventurous travelers might try paragliding from the pass, gliding over the coastline in a rush of adrenaline before landing near the coast. On other days, you can drive down toward the beaches: Dhërmi, Jale, or the bays closer to Vlora, spending the afternoon by the water before returning to the cool calm of the mountains at dusk.
